The turnpike was a toll road which could only be used on rainless days. True False

Respuesta :

Greenleafable
Greenleafable Greenleafable
  • 07-11-2016
This should be false.

Rain has nothing to do with the toll road turnpike system. It has to do with paying for using the road.
